Rem drv: Rem Rem $Header: ecm_schema_downgrade.sql 30-aug-2005.00:52:36 mningomb Exp $ Rem Rem ecm_schema_downgrade.sql Rem Rem Copyright (c) 2005, Oracle. All rights reserved. Rem Rem NAME Rem ecm_schema_downgrade.sql - Rem Rem DESCRIPTION Rem Rem Rem NOTES Rem Rem Rem MODIFIED (MM/DD/YY) Rem mningomb 08/28/05 - Rem chyu 07/19/05 - modifying the new rep manager header Rem pdasika 07/11/05 - Dropping types created for bug 4407016 Rem abhalla 07/07/05 - Drop new table MGMT_CPF_METRIC_SOURCE of 10.2 Rem asaraswa 03/04/05 - dropping mgmt_inv_summary table Rem apbharga 02/23/05 - apbharga_ecm_downgrade Rem apbharga 02/23/05 - Created Rem Rem Defines for column sizes DEFINE DISPLAY_NAME_LENGTH = 128 DEFINE TARGET_NAME_LENGTH = 256 Rem Downgrading MGMT_BUG_ADV_HOME_PATCH Rem In 10.2 we added a new column BUG_NUMBER as part of the Primary Key Rem Since the dependent views, procs and data will be recreated, I am going to simply drop the Rem table and create the old table DROP TABLE MGMT_BUG_ADV_HOME_PATCH; CREATE TABLE MGMT_BUG_ADV_HOME_PATCH ( ADVISORY_NAME VARCHAR2(&DISPLAY_NAME_LENGTH) NOT NULL, HOST_NAME VARCHAR2(&TARGET_NAME_LENGTH) NOT NULL, HOME_LOCATION VARCHAR2( 128 ) NOT NULL, PATCH_GUID RAW(16) NOT NULL, PREREQ_RELEASE VARCHAR2(256), HOME_LOCATION_DISPLAY VARCHAR2(256), TARGET_GUID RAW(16), CONSTRAINT MBAHP_PK PRIMARY KEY ( ADVISORY_NAME, HOST_NAME, HOME_LOCATION, PATCH_GUID ) ) MONITORING; DROP TABLE MGMT_INV_SUMMARY; DROP TYPE VARCHAR_TABLE; DROP TYPE HOME_CREDS_REC_TYPE; DROP TYPE HOME_CRED_ARRAY; DROP TYPE DEST_PLATFORM_REC_TYPE; DROP TYPE DEST_PLATFORM_ARRAY;